20357. Adulteration of candy. U. S. v. 4 Boxes, etc. (F. D. C. Nos. 34598, 34599. Sample Nos. 38904-L to 38906-L, incl.) LIBEL FILED : On or about January 19,1953, Western District of Virginia. ALLEGED SHIPMENT : On or about November 17,1952, by the Anderson Candy Co., from Wilmington, N. C. PRODUCT: 12 boxes of candy, each box containing 25 candy bars, at Roanoke, Va. LABEL IN PART: (BOX) "Peco [or "Cocoanut"] Flake." NATURE OF CHARGE: Adulteration, Section 402 (a) (3), the product consisted in whole or in part of a filthy substance by reason of the presence of insect parts and rodent hair fragments; and, Section 402 (a) (4)? it had been pre- pared under insanitary conditions whereby it may have become contaminated with filth. DISPOSITION : May 6, 1953. Default decree of condemnation and destruction.
